POSITION OVERVIEW
This position will support the EMC Validation Team in fulfilling testing data analysis and issue debugging duties. This position will report to the EMC Validation Manager.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Listen for Instructions take notes ask questions and explain procedures to confirm requirements are understood before starting any testing.
Support EMC Validation engineers in day-to-day activities including module reflash part logging and issue tracking
Support EMC validation engineer on test data analysis and reporting
Support EMC validation engineering on test issue debug and tracking
Testing of electronic modules during development (ED) DV (Design Validation) and PV (Production Validation).
Includes: working directly with a EMC Validation Engineer (EVE) to review understand and execute test instructions. Part sample management test setups environmental chamber operation sample analysis prep logging data acquisition and reporting.
Work with electronic module test stands to ensure correct setups and execution of active testing on modules.
Perform diagnostics repair and maintenance of electronic test stands as well as harness build debug and repair.
Work with other department associates to ensure full proxy/backup of all key responsibilities.
Ability to manage priorities and support multi-tasking activities self-driven to seek out additional work during slower periods.
Support parts storage practices labeling and Fixtures organization.
